Position Summary
We are seeking a Tax Manager to join our growing team. The ideal candidate has strong public accounting tax experience, enjoys building client relationships, and is passionate about mentoring and developing staff.
This position follows a hybrid work schedule outside of busy season, allowing flexibility while maintaining collaboration with the team. During busy season, team members are expected to primarily work from the office to best serve our clients and support one another.
As a Tax Manager, you'll manage client engagements, review tax returns, develop staff, and work directly with firm leadership on tax planning, client service, and operational initiatives. You'll have a meaningful voice in business decisions and the opportunity to help shape the future direction of the firm.
While this position is posted as a Tax Manager, highly qualified candidates may be hired directly as a Senior Tax Manager. Title and compensation will be determined based on experience, technical expertise, leadership ability, and overall qualifications.
Responsibilities
- Manage a portfolio of business and individual tax clients.
- Review federal and state individual, partnership, S corporation, C corporation, fiduciary, and nonprofit tax returns.
- Prepare complex tax returns as needed.
- Research federal and state tax issues.
- Develop proactive tax planning strategies for clients.
- Mentor, train, and develop staff accountants.
- Review staff work and provide constructive feedback.

Qualifications
- Bachelor's degree in Accounting or a related field required.
- Minimum of four tax seasons of public accounting experience preparing and reviewing individual and business tax returns required.
- CPA Preferred
- Demonstrated leadership experience or a strong desire to mentor and develop staff.
- Strong understanding of federal income tax principles.
- Excellent analytical, organizational, and communication skills.
- Ability to manage multiple engagements and deadlines.
- Commitment to providing exceptional client service.
- Proficiency with Microsoft Excel and Microsoft Office.
- Experience with Lacerte Tax software is a plus.
- Experience with Quick Books Online, Safe Send, Sure Prep, Karbon, or other cloud-based accounting software is a plus.
